In addition, here are the questions that were raised during the panel discussion. >> >>* Use of packages, how to organize items in a registry? >>* Taxonomies and classifications, what's the difference? >>* OAIS: integrity of objects over time >>* How to integrate 11179 and ebXML >>* Persistent locations in registries (DRIve) >>* How to register namespaces? >>* Multi-lingual capabilities >>* URI for RegistryObject >> >>The third question (Integrity of objects over time) was asked specifically by Derek Lane, from EPA. More detail on his question follows: >> >>1. Comparison between the two concepts ebXML Reg/Rep with OAIS [Reference Model for an Open Archival Information System (OAIS)] >>2. Capability to ensure integrity of objects over time >>3. If a checksum may be required to ensure that the object is what was submitted over time (mentioned by Lane in discussion). >> >>Please respond with answers on the third question (details 1-3 above) directly to the list and Derek Lane at lane.derek@epa.gov The link to OAIS is at: http://ssdoo.gsfc.nasa.gov/nost/isoas/overview.html >> >>Please also feel free to discuss each of the other questions above on the list.
